Scope:
~~~~~~
Mobile computing aims at ubiquitous user access to computer
application. To make it possible, networking technology which enables
Internet access anytime and everywhere, i.e. ubiquitous networking is
necessary. It is obvious that with the accelerating trends towards
mobile networks, ad-hoc networks, and wireless networks, mobile
computing and ubiquitous networking will play an important role in
future network. This conference is aimed at providing researchers and
practitioners in this hot research area a forum for discussion and
collaboration. Authors are invited to submit papers addressing, but
not limited to, the following topics:
- Applications and services for mobile computing
- Network architectures, protocols, or service models for ubiquitous
networking
- Network management for ubiquitous networking
- Data management for mobile computing
- Security in mobile computing and ubiquitous networking
- Wireless and mobile communications
- Nomadic computing
- Ad-hoc networks
- Mobile Internetworking
- Performance evaluation for mobile computing and ubiquitous
networking systems
- Broadcast communication

Location and Date:
~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
The location of the NTT DoCoMo R&D Center is in the heart of Yokosuka
Research Park(YRP) where a lot of wireless communication related
research institutes are established. YRP is really the heart of
wireless communications research in Japan. Japanese old city Kamakura,
a famous historic city, is 30 minutes by train. Beginning of the year
is one of the best seasons for visiting Japan.
